💡 Did You Know?
- Slick City Action Park features 10 uniquely themed slides including signature attractions like Mega Launch (drop slide), Big Wave (half-pipe), and Long Jump (aerial launch slide), offering varied intensity levels from gentle to extreme
- The facility is brand new and specifically designed with dedicated soft play zones (Junior Jungle and Web Crawler) for children ages 5 and under, plus separate pricing for ages 3 and under at $14.99
- Slick City implements a time-slot ticketing system (90 or 120 minutes) to prevent overcrowding, allowing guests to maximize ride time by visiting during off-peak hours like 1:00pm opening
- The venue offers specialized adult-only nights and quiet sessions in addition to standard family hours, expanding appeal beyond traditional family entertainment center demographics
💬 What Visitors Say
- Arrive right when the park opens at 1:00 PM on weekdays to avoid crowds and maximize your time on slides with minimal wait times. Time slot system prevents overcrowding, making early arrival the key to the best experience.
- Book a 90-minute session for solo visitors or small groups, but choose 120 minutes if visiting with multiple children so they have enough time to try all equipment multiple times without feeling rushed.
- Some slides feature intense steep drops (Rush, Mega Launch) that aren't suitable for all children. Review your child's comfort level with heights beforehand and start with gentler slides like the Junior Jungle zone for younger or more cautious kids.
- Budget $39-44 total per person for a 90-minute visit (includes $28.99-33.99 ticket, $4.99 mandatory socks, and ~$2 online booking fee). Food and beverages are available on-site, so you can stay inside rather than leaving to eat elsewhere.
- The facility is brand new, clean, and spacious with plenty of seating for parents to watch. Staff are knowledgeable and helpful, making it ideal for mixed-age groups where adults and children can enjoy activities separately or together.
